Questions: 1a) When have you felt like saying, “This isn’t what I signed up for” in your Christian life or service? 1b) What made you feel that way, and how did you respond? 2a) Have you ever faced embarrassment, mockery, or rejection for faithfully speaking or living out God’s Word? 2b) How did it affect your desire to keep going? 3a) What does Jeremiah’s honesty about his discouragement teach you about how to handle your own spiritual struggles? 3b) Do you feel freedom to bring your pain before God as Jeremiah did? 4) Do you feel like God’s Word is “a fire in your bones”? If not, what might be dulling your passion to share the Gospel? 5) How do you respond to discouragement – retreat, bitterness, prayer, praise, or something else? 6a) Where might the devil be using the “drill of discouragement” in your life right now? 6b) What truths from this sermon can help you resist and keep going?
